The Institute of Public Administration (IPA)—one of Ireland’s most eminent higher learning institutions—specialises in part-time education programmes in public administration and public management. Generations of public servants have passed through its doors, many of whom have gone on to occupy some of the highest positions in the State. The Whitaker School of Government and Management at the IPA provides accredited, internationally recognised education programmes in all areas of public management. Its various programmes in business studies attract students from the public and private sector alike.
The IPA also has Ireland’s only dedicated public management research and publishing resource. The Institute publishes books and periodicals, including the journal Administration, in the areas of public management and governance. In addition, the IPA provides a variety of consultancy services, for which there is a strong demand both nationally and internationally.
The provision of high-quality, part-time training and education programmes is at the heart of the IPA’s mission. Attracting students from across the wider public sector, from the private sector, and from the voluntary sector, the IPA’s certificates, diplomas and degrees are designed to fit into the busy lifestyles of adult learners and to meet their professional needs. As they can be taken in a way that suits a student’s particular circumstances, they are an ideal choice for those who want to return to education while keeping their various personal and professional commitments.
